搜索引擎优化(SEO)中,黑帽技术通常被视为违反搜索协议的行为。然而,在专业和道德的背景下,了解如何识别哪些页面已被搜索引擎索引是至关重要的。这种知识可以帮助网站管理员更好地管理其网站结构,提升用户体验,并确保遵循搜索引擎的最佳实践。本文将深入探讨黑帽SEO软件是如何识别已索引页面的。
一、理解搜索引擎的工作原理
为了有效地使用任何工具来检测页面是否已被搜索引擎索引,首先要了解搜索引擎的基本工作流程。主要步骤包括网页抓取(爬虫任务)、索引构建和检索(查询响应)。当一个网站被提交给搜索引擎时,其服务器会根据设定的频率发送网页抓取指令至目标网址,并将获取的内容存储在数据库中。
二、黑帽SEO软件的基本操作逻辑

黑帽SEO工具的工作方式
这类工具通常模拟人类行为或利用现有的API接口来查询和监控页面的状态。它们主要通过两种方式进行:一种是通过搜索结果直接访问,另一种则是使用搜索引擎提供的公开信息和服务。前者依赖于网络爬虫技术,后者则可能涉及提交特定的XML文件或是利用官方提供的API。
公开API与XML Sitemap
许多搜索引擎提供了标准的接口如Google Search Console API、Bing Webmaster Tools等,允许用户获取关于其网站被索引的信息。这些工具能够帮助识别哪些页面已被收录以及其相关排名信息。同时,网站管理员还可以创建并提交Sitemap文件至搜索引擎,以便更好地控制和管理其内容的可见性。

三、具体方法与技术应用
网站管理员工具
利用Google Search Console或Bing Webmaster Tools等服务可以查看哪些URL已被索引。这些平台提供了详细的报告功能,包括每个页面在搜索结果中的展示情况以及遇到的问题提示。网站所有者还可以使用这些工具提交新内容、移除过时或不希望显示的网页,并跟踪其效果。
伪静态检测与robots.txt文件

通过检查robots.txt文件可以了解哪些资源是可以被搜索引擎访问和索引的。虽然这不能直接告知页面是否已被收录,但结合其他方法可间接得出结论。伪静态链接是另一种常用的技术手段,它利用URL重写规则来模仿传统静态页面的行为,从而更容易地通过自动化脚本进行检测。
自动化抓取与API调用
开发人员可以编写程序模拟人类行为从搜索引擎获取信息。这种方法虽然复杂且可能违反服务条款,但在某些情况下仍被允许使用。例如,开发者可能会定期访问指定的搜索结果URL并解析返回的内容以判断哪些页面已被索引。此外,通过分析HTTP响应头中的状态码(如200、404等)也能获得一定信息。
四、注意事项与伦理考量
尽管掌握这些技术有助于优化网站性能和SEO策略,但必须遵循各搜索引擎的相关规定。滥用黑帽SEO手段不仅可能导致账户被封禁或处罚,还会影响用户体验及信任度。因此,在实施任何高级检测方法之前,请务必确保遵守行业标准并考虑长远利益。
总之,了解如何通过各种方式识别页面是否已被搜索引擎索引对于网站管理者来说至关重要。这不仅能帮助他们更有效地进行优化工作,还能促进网络环境的整体健康与发展。同时也要时刻提醒自己:合法合规永远是最重要的原则之一。